9. Explore the Museum Haus Lange and Museum Haus Esters

Image source: https://www.outdooractive.com/en/poi/duesseldorf-und-umgebung/haus-lange-and-haus-esters-museums/50964286/

The Museum Haus Lange and Museum Haus Esters are two beautiful modernist houses located in Krefeld. The houses were designed by the famous architect Ludwig Mies van der Rohe and now house modern art exhibitions.
